BODY {
	MARGIN-TOP: 0px; FONT-SIZE: 12px; LINE-HEIGHT: 14px
}
H1 {
	FONT-SIZE: 12px; MARGIN: 0px; LINE-HEIGHT: 14px
}
H2 {
	FONT-SIZE: 12px; MARGIN: 0px; LINE-HEIGHT: 14px
}
.size08_10 {
	FONT-SIZE: 9px; LINE-HEIGHT: 9px
}
.size09_09 {
	FONT-SIZE: 9px; LINE-HEIGHT: 9px
}
.size09_11 {
	FONT-SIZE: 9px; LINE-HEIGHT: 11px
}
.size10_10 {
	FONT-SIZE: 10px; LINE-HEIGHT: 10px
}
.size10_12 {
	FONT-SIZE: 10px; LINE-HEIGHT: 12px
}
.size10_14 {
	FONT-SIZE: 10px; LINE-HEIGHT: 14px
}
.size10_16 {
	FONT-SIZE: 10px; LINE-HEIGHT: 16px
}
.size11_14 {
	FONT-SIZE: 11px; LINE-HEIGHT: 14px
}
.size12_10 {
	FONT-SIZE: 12px; LINE-HEIGHT: 10px
}
.size12_12 {
	FONT-SIZE: 12px; LINE-HEIGHT: 12px
}
.size12_14 {
	FONT-SIZE: 12px; LINE-HEIGHT: 14px
}
.size12_16 {
	FONT-SIZE: 12px; LINE-HEIGHT: 16px
}
.size12_18 {
	FONT-SIZE: 12px; LINE-HEIGHT: 18px
}
.size14_14 {
	FONT-SIZE: 14px; LINE-HEIGHT: 14px
}
.size14_16 {
	FONT-SIZE: 14px; LINE-HEIGHT: 16px
}
.size14_18 {
	FONT-SIZE: 14px; LINE-HEIGHT: 18px
}
.size14_20 {
	FONT-SIZE: 14px; LINE-HEIGHT: 20px
}
.size16_20 {
	FONT-SIZE: 16px; LINE-HEIGHT: 20px
}
.size24_24 {
	FONT-SIZE: 24px; LINE-HEIGHT: normal
}
A:link {
	COLOR: #444444; TEXT-DECORATION: none
}
A:visited {
	COLOR: #444444; TEXT-DECORATION: none
}
A:hover {
	COLOR: #444444; TEXT-DECORATION: underline
}
.bg_green {
	BACKGROUND-COLOR: #7ac1cc
}
.bg2 {
	BACKGROUND-POSITION: left top; BACKGROUND-IMAGE: url(img/bg2.gif); BACKGROUND-REPEAT: repeat-y
}
DIV.white {
	FONT-SIZE: 12px; COLOR: #ffffff; LINE-HEIGHT: 14px
}
.price {
	FONT-WEIGHT: bold; FONT-SIZE: 18px; COLOR: #cc0000; LINE-HEIGHT: 18px
}
TD.orange {
	FONT-SIZE: 12px; COLOR: #ffffff; LINE-HEIGHT: 14px; BACKGROUND-COLOR: #f7aa2d
}
.bg_tab01 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_01.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ab02 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_02.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ab03 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_03.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ab04 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_04.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ab05 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_05.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ab06 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_06.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ab07 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_07.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ab08 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_08.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ab09 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_09.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ab10 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_10.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ab11 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_11.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ab12 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/12.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ab13 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_13.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
.bg_tab14 {
	BACKGROUND-POSITION: left top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/tab_14.gif); COLOR: #3f3f3f;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; TEXT-ALIGN: center
}
TD.a {
	BACKGROUND-IMAGE: url(img/bg03.gif); BACKGROUND-REPEAT: repeat-x; HEIGHT: 1px
}
TD.d {
	BACKGROUND-POSITION: left bottom; BACKGROUND-IMAGE: url(img/bg03.gif); BACKGROUND-REPEAT: repeat-x; HEIGHT: 1px
}
TD.b {
	BACKGROUND-POSITION: left 50%; BACKGROUND-IMAGE: url(img/bg03.gif); BACKGROUND-REPEAT: repeat-y; HEIGHT: 1px
}
TD.c {
	BACKGROUND-POSITION: right 50%; BACKGROUND-IMAGE: url(img/bg03.gif); BACKGROUND-REPEAT: repeat-y; HEIGHT: 1px
}
.bgs {
	BACKGROUND-POSITION: right top; BACKGROUND-IMAGE: url(img/bg_s.jpg); BACKGROUND-REPEAT: no-repeat
}
.bgc {
	BACKGROUND-POSITION: right top; BACKGROUND-IMAGE: url(img/bg_c.jpg); BACKGROUND-REPEAT: no-repeat
}
.map {
	BACKGROUND-POSITION: left top; BACKGROUND-IMAGE: url(img/bg05.gif); BACKGROUND-REPEAT: repeat-y
}
.map2 {
	BACKGROUND-POSITION: left top; BACKGROUND-IMAGE: url(img/bg04.gif); BACKGROUND-REPEAT: no-repeat
}
#oritatami UL.open {
	DISPLAY: block
}
#oritatami UL.close {
	DISPLAY: none
}
#oritatami LI.open {
	LIST-STYLE-IMAGE: url(img/folclose.gif); OVERFLOW: hidden; WHITE-SPACE: nowrap; LIST-STYLE-TYPE: disc; 150: 
}
#oritatami LI.close {
	LIST-STYLE-IMAGE: url(img/folclose.gif); OVERFLOW: hidden; WHITE-SPACE: nowrap; LIST-STYLE-TYPE: circle; 150: 
}
#oritatami LI.nochild {
	LIST-STYLE-IMAGE: url(IEico.gif); LIST-STYLE-TYPE: circle
}
#oritatami LI {
	LIST-STYLE-TYPE: square
}
.line {
	BACKGROUND-POSITION: center top; BACKGROUND-IMAGE: url(img/line.gif); BACKGROUND-REPEAT: repeat-y
}
.bg12 {
	BACKGROUND-POSITION: 143px 32px;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/12.gif); COLOR: #666666;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; FONT-FAMILY: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"
}
.newbg {
	BACKGROUND-POSITION: 50% top;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/topnew_bgimg2.jpg); COLOR: #444444; L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at; FONT-FAMILY: "‚l‚r ‚oƒSƒVƒbƒN", "Osaka"
}
.menubg {
	BACKGROUND-POSITION: center bottom; BACKGROUND-IMAGE: url(img/bg.jpg); BACKGROUND-REPEAT: no-repeat; BACKGROUND-COLOR: #d1e7ed
}
.menubg2 {
	BACKGROUND-POSITION: center bottom; BACKGROUND-IMAGE: url(img/bg2-2.jpg); BACKGROUND-REPEAT: no-repeat; BACKGROUND-COLOR: #fff1eb
}
.dotbg {
	BACKGROUND-POSITION: center top; BACKGROUND-IMAGE: url(img/dotbg.jpg); BACKGROUND-REPEAT: no-repeat
}
.com {
	BACKGROUND-POSITION: center center;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/com.gif); L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at
}
.biyoubg {
	BACKGROUND-POSITION: center center; FONT-WEIGHT: bold;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/biyou_bg.jpg); L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at
}
.dietbg {
	BACKGROUND-POSITION: right top; BACKGROUND-IMAGE: url(img/tea01a.jpg); BACKGROUND-REPEAT: no-repeat
}
.air {
	BACKGROUND-POSITION: right top; BACKGROUND-IMAGE: url(img/sora.jpg); BACKGROUND-REPEAT: no-repeat
}
.diettopbg {
	BACKGROUND-POSITION: right top; BACKGROUND-IMAGE: url(img/diet_top_bg.gif); BACKGROUND-REPEAT: no-repeat
}
.kmw {
	BACKGROUND-POSITION: center center;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/kmwbg.jpg); L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at
}
.kyousou {
	BACKGROUND-POSITION: center center; FONT-SIZE: 12px; BACKGROUND-IMAGE: url(img/kmw_image2.jpg); LINE-HEIGHT: 14px; BACKGROUND-REPEAT: no-repeat
}
.out_test {
	BORDER-RIGHT: gray 0px solid; BORDER-TOP: 0px solid; FONT-WEIGHT: bold; FONT-SIZE: 16px; BORDER-LEFT: gray 0px solid; COLOR: #cc0000; BORDER-BOTTOM: gray 0px solid; BACKGROUND-COLOR: #ffffff
}
